Can we walk away from buyer’s agent?

 In RealEstate

We’ve been touring houses for a year now but haven’t found anything in our budget. We’ve been working with a buyer’s agent who sometimes comes out on the tours with us and get us documents.

Now a friend of a friend is selling their house and offering us an off-market sale. It’s really tempting. Just talked to the seller’s agent who said “the expectation is he’d represent both parties.”

Can we just… walk away from our buyer’s agent to do the dual representation plan? We haven’t signed any kind of contract with him…

This is in Seattle, in case that matters. I guess Northwest MLS is the local MLS.

P.s. anticipating questions: the house is in good shape. The price is exactly our budget. But I think it’ll sell for more than they’re asking if we wait till it’s publicly listed.
